我最近一直在尝试寻找一种快速有效的方法来使用Python语言在两个数组之间执行互相关检查。经过一番阅读,我发现了这两个选项:NumPy.correlate()方法,在处理大型数组时速度太慢。cv.MatchTemplate()方法,看起来速度更快。出于显而易见的原因,我选择了第二个选项。我尝试执行以下代码:importscipyimportcvimage=cv.fromarray(scipy.float32(scipy.asarray([1,2,2,1])),allowND=True)template=cv.fromarray(scipy.float32(scipy.asarray([
一、数据定义1、Tensor(torch、mindspore等框架下) 张量是在深度学习框架中的一个数据结构,个人理解就是这个框架的输入数据必须是tensor格式,比如一张图片进来,需要转化成tensor格式输入到网络中,再在框架进行一系列的操作,等模型训练完了,用不到这个框架了,可以把这个tensor取出来,转换成别的需要进一步操作的数据类型(例如array,list等)2、array(numpy)数组结构是由不同维度的list转换来的,用array的原因主要在于有更多的矩阵操作,数据使用起来更方便,比如转置、矩阵相乘、reshape等等二、互相转换1、array转listimportnum
一、前言 最近项目上需要用到抽离的组件来实现一些功能。现在将组件使用过程中的遇到的一些问题进行分享。二、父页面引用子组件及使用 1、引用 在父页面的.json文件中,添加上组件。如下代码所示,“usingComponents”的值是一个对象,里面添加子组件。其中冒号前面的为子组件的名字(用在父页面中,可自定义),冒号后面的是子组件的路径。{"usingComponents":{"rylist":"../../../components/zylist/zylist","inputContent":"../../../components/inputContent/inp
一、背景在uni-app开发过程中,有时候会遇到uni-app插件或者提供的api对硬件操作不太友好,需要使用原生Android开发对应模块,为了使得双方通信方便,特意封装了一个接口,可实现Android与Uni-app互相通讯。二、内容做完以下第一、第二部分,即可实现Android与uni-app互相通信,当然双方通信有不同方式,具体情况具体分析,我的采用的方案是写Android原生插件,在uni-app中集成Android原生插件方式实现。1、原生Android部分Android原生涉及到的几个类,MyEvent.java(传递消息的ben类),MyEventManager.java类作用
我是Go的新手,我的代码中有一件事我不明白。我写了一个简单的冒泡排序算法(我知道它不是很有效;))。现在我想启动3个GoRoutines。每个线程都应该独立于其他线程对其数组进行排序。完成后,函数。应该打印一条“完成”消息。这是我的代码:packagemainimport("fmt""time"//fortimefunctionse.g.Now()"math/rand"//forpseudorandomnumbers)/*Simplebubblesortalgorithm*/funcbubblesort(strstring,a[]int)[]int{forn:=len(a);n>1;n
1.正态分布参考博客:https://www.cnblogs.com/htj10/p/8621771.html概率密度函数的意义:理解概率密度函数-知乎(zhihu.com)若随机变量 服从一个位置参数为、尺度参数为的概率分布,且其概率密度函数为::是正态分布的位置参数,描述正态分布的集中趋势位置。概率规律为取与邻近的值的概率大,而取离越远的值的概率越小。正态分布以为对称轴,左右完全对称。正态分布的期望、均数、中位数、众数相同,均等于。 位置(形状)参数控制分布函数形状的变化。:是正态分布的尺度参数,描述正态分布资料数据分布的离散程度,越大,数据分布越分散,越小,数据分布越集中。也称为是正态分
近日又有一个社区迷惑走红上万个AI发帖聊天,人类不得入内?据红星新闻报道近日,一个名为Chirper的AI网络社区突然爆火上万个AI聊天机器人在其中激烈地聊天、互动、分享 社区主页右上角明确写着: “这是一个人工智能的社交网络,人类不得入内。”社区右上角明确规定“人类不得入内”这个AI社区神似推特,平台规则非常简单每位真实用户注册后可以创建最多5个AI人格创建后,这些AI人格会自顾自地聊天、互动Chirper社区规定人类在创建了AI人格之后只能“袖手旁观”禁止人类参与聊天仅可以像刷微博一样观看AI们聊天这个社区和推特微博神似,AI会自动发帖回帖互动用户注册后只需要填写AI的用户名给出一段描述
在这个系统中,我们存储产品、产品图像(一个产品可以有多个图像)和一个产品的默认图像。数据库:CREATETABLE`products`(`ID`int(10)unsignedNOTNULLAUTO_INCREMENT,`NAME`varchar(255)NOTNULL,`DESCRIPTION`textNOTNULL,`ENABLED`tinyint(1)NOTNULLDEFAULT'1',`DATEADDED`datetimeNOTNULL,`DEFAULT_PICTURE_ID`int(10)unsignedDEFAULTNULL,PRIMARYKEY(`ID`),KEY`Inde
我有各种时间序列,我想将它们相互关联-或者更确切地说,交叉关联-以找出相关因子在哪个时间滞后时最大。我发现variousquestions和答案/链接讨论了如何使用numpy进行操作,但这意味着我必须将我的数据帧转换为numpy数组。而且由于我的时间序列经常涵盖不同的时期,我怕我会陷入困惑。编辑我在使用所有numpy/scipy方法时遇到的问题是,它们似乎缺乏对我数据的时间序列性质的认识。当我将1940年开始的时间序列与1970年开始的时间序列相关联时,pandascorr知道这一点,而np.correlate只产生1020个条目(更长的系列)充满nan的数组。关于这个主题的各种Q表明
一、关于Git的安装与配置,可以参考这两篇文章Git详细安装教程(详解Git安装过程的每一个步骤)GitHub的安装与配置二、同步本地文件与代码仓常规流程1、在github上创建项目2、使用gitclonehttps://github.com/xxxxxxx/xxxxx.git克隆到本地3、编辑项目【增、删、改】gitstatus##查看修改的状态gitdiff.##查看修改的具体不同4、gitadd.(将改动添加到暂存区)5、gitcommit-m"提交说明"6、gitpushoriginmaster将本地更改推送到远程master分支。这样你就完成了向远程仓库的推送。三、常见问题1、本地创